Harbor is seeking a highly skilled and motivated Team Lead – Business Intelligence to join our Financial Systems consulting team. This role combines people leadership with hands-on delivery, managing a team of BI Developers while actively contributing to client-facing engagements. The Team Lead will play a critical role in delivering high-quality financial reporting, analytics, and data-driven insights for our law firm clients. This individual will ensure strong alignment between client needs, internal standards, and technical best practices, while fostering a collaborative and high-performance team environment.
Harbor’s team of business and technology experts provides professional services firms with strategic consulting, software expertise, and data-driven solutions to enhance performance. We enable our clients to leverage their systems and data more effectively, helping them operate efficiently, strengthen client relationships, and improve profitability. This is a full-time, fully remote position that can be based anywhere in the United States, United Kingdom or Canada.
The Team Lead – Business Intelligence is responsible for leading a team of four BI Developers, balancing approximately 20% leadership responsibilities with 80% hands-on delivery and client utilization. The ideal candidate brings deep expertise in law firm financial systems, reporting frameworks, and BI tools, along with proven leadership experience. This role requires a strong combination of technical capability, client engagement skills, and team management.
Job Duties and Responsibilities:
Team Leadership & Management
Lead, mentor, and develop a team of four Business Intelligence Developers
Assign, prioritize, and monitor workloads to ensure timely delivery of high-quality outputs
Conduct performance management activities, including coaching, feedback, and evaluations
Foster a collaborative, accountable, and high-performing team culture
Client Delivery & Utilization (80%)
Act as a hands-on contributor across BI projects, including report development, dashboard creation, semantic/tabular model design, and DAX measure development
Partner with clients and internal stakeholders to gather, refine, and translate business requirements into technical solutions
Deliver high-quality reporting and analytics solutions tailored to law firm operational needs
Ensure adherence to BI development standards, data governance practices, and documentation requirements
Financial Reporting & Analytics
Design and develop reporting solutions for key law firm financial metrics, including:
Revenue, profitability, and realization
Billing, collections, and Work in Progress (WIP)
Timekeeper performance and utilization
Translate complex financial and operational data into clear, actionable, well-designed reports and dashboards
Improve reporting efficiency through automation and optimized data models
Technical Oversight
Provide guidance on BI tools and technologies (e.g., Power BI, Fa bric , SQL, data lakes )
Ensure data integrity, accuracy, and consistency across all reporting solutions
Review and validate deliverables produced by team members
Support best practices in semantic/tabular modeling, DAX, performance tuning, and solution design
